Rob Cohen is another one of those extremely talented Canadians that is always behind the scenes writing or producing. He is not a high profile talent like Ben Stiller, David Cross or even Dana Gould. But that hasnt stopped him from writing on some of the most popular shows of this comedy generation. From the Flaming Moes episode of The Simpsons to The Ben Stiller Show [for which he won an Emmy] to this falls new primetime animated show, Father of the Pride.
